In Santa's room, there are 144 books in two bookcases. One bookcase has 20 more books than the other. How many books are in each bookcase?

Solution

Let x represent the number of books first bookcase

Then x +20 number of books in the second bookcase

Since, the total number of books is 144

Therefore


\begin{gathered} x+x+20=144 \\ 2x+20=144 \\ 2x=144-20 \\ 2x=124 \\ divide\text{ both sides byn2} \\ (2x)/(2)=(124)/(2) \\ \\ x=62books \end{gathered}

The second bookcase


\begin{gathered} x+20 \\ 62+20 \\ =82books \end{gathered}
